Output d32b59ceeafdbf8b8c711e80a1183825789a68d6ebf0b3d2af32fab176350056:6

value
99802
script pubkey
OP_0 OP_PUSHBYTES_20 ecbc46244a3e88bcb1ad5c94705dddacd35c9aa7
address
bc1qaj7yvfz286ytevddtj28qhwa4nf4ex48cmh4ar
transaction
d32b59ceeafdbf8b8c711e80a1183825789a68d6ebf0b3d2af32fab176350056
spent
true